How they compare

Sri Lanka currently reports 138 m3 against 95 m3 in Sudan (former), a difference of 43 m3.

That makes Sri Lanka's figure about 1.5 times Sudan (former)'s.

Across all 7 years both countries report, Sri Lanka has been ahead every year.

Sri Lanka ranks 5th and Sudan (former) ranks 7th of 48 countries.

Sri Lanka has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
